A fast scatter plot
h=fastscatter(X,Y,C [,markertype,property-value pairs])
Inputs:
X,Y: coordinates
C: color
Examples:
N=100000;
fastscatter(randn(N,1),randn(N,1),randn(N,1))
N=100;
fastscatter(randn(N,1),randn(N,1),randn(N,1),'+','markersize',7)

An illustrative example of the speed-up when using fastscatter over scatter:
N=200000;
X=randn(N,1);Y=randn(N,1);C=X.^2+Y.^2+randn(N,1);S=ones(N,1);
tic; for ii=1:10, clf; fastscatter(X,Y,C); drawnow; end; fastscatter_time=toc
tic; for ii=1:10, clf; scatter(X,Y,S,C); drawnow; end; regularscatter_time=toc
speed_increase=regularscatter_time/fastscatter_time
fastscatter_time = 3.4 seconds
regularscatter_time = 63.3 seconds
speed_increase = 18x
And for N=400000, the performance boost was ~38x.
